Michael Leavitt is a judge for the Fifth Judicial District Juvenile Court in Utah. He was appointed by Governor Gary Herbert on May 9, 2014 to replace Karla Staheli and was confirmed by the Utah State Senate on June 18, 2014.[1][2]
Education
Leavitt received his undergraduate degree from Southern Utah University in 197 and his J.D. from the University of Idaho, College of Law in 2002.[1][3]
Career
- 2014-Present: Judge, Fifth Judicial District
- 2002-2014: Attorney, Durham Jones & Pinegar
- 2004-2006: Teacher, Dixie State College [1]
Awards and associations
- Member, Utah State Bar Board of Commissioners [1]
